How to Play Shapes
The beauty of Infinity Games' design lies in its accessibility. Whether you want to play Shapes online free in a browser or download it on a tablet, the learning curve is virtually non-existent, even if the puzzles themselves scale in difficulty.
Core Controls
- Desktop/Chromebook: Click the Left Mouse Button on a fragment to rotate it 90 degrees.
- Touch Devices (Android/Tablet): Tap a fragment to rotate it.
Gameplay Objectives
Your sole objective is to rotate the fragments until all loose ends connect, forming a cohesive, closed shape. The level is complete the moment the hidden figure is correctly assembled. As you progress, the shapes become more intricate, introducing complex geometric patterns and requiring deeper spatial awareness.
The "Ad Fatigue" Meta: How to Play Uninterrupted
While Shapes offers an excellent brain game experience, the most prominent complaint from the community revolves around aggressive monetization. Ads frequently interrupt gameplay, sometimes popping up the exact moment you start a new level. This shatters the minimalist, relaxing vibe the game aims for.
The Ultimate Workaround: The game fully supports offline play. To bypass the intrusive ad frequency reported by thousands of users, simply turn off your device's Wi-Fi and mobile data before launching the app. Because the puzzles are stored locally, you can play through hundreds of levels seamlessly. This single configuration tip transforms a frustrating, ad-heavy experience into a seamless, therapeutic journey.
Is Shapes Safe for Kids?
Parents often search for "Shapes games for kindergarten" or early development tools, and this game is a fantastic candidate, provided you set it up correctly.
- Educational Value: The game heavily enhances problem-solving and logical skills. It serves as an excellent 2D shapes matching game, teaching children how different geometric fragments interact.
- Content Suitability: There is absolutely no violence, chat, or multiplayer interaction. It is purely a single-player puzzle environment.
- Drawbacks for Early Learners: The game lacks voice-over audio for object names. When a child completes a shape (like a dog or a star), the game does not say the word aloud, missing a minor opportunity for vocabulary building. Furthermore, you must utilize the offline trick mentioned above; otherwise, kids will be subjected to frequent, potentially distracting advertisements immediately upon starting.

Pro Tips & Strategy
- Start with the Outliers: Look for fragments that have dead ends. These are usually the outer edges of the shape and can act as anchor points for the rest of the puzzle.
- Use the Offline Exploit: As mentioned, disconnecting from the internet is the strongest "strategy" for keeping your focus intact and avoiding ad fatigue.
- Look for Symmetry: Many hidden images in Shapes are perfectly symmetrical. If you solve one half of the board, mirror those rotations on the opposite side.
- Spam-Clicking isn't a Strategy: While there is no penalty for rotating pieces endlessly, blindly clicking will confuse your spatial mapping. Stop, look at the angles, and visualize the line trajectories before moving a piece.
